Catoctin CASS Advisory Council

The Catoctin CASS Advisory Council is an advisory board to the Catoctin CASS Coordinator. The Council is presently made up of the following nine individuals that represent nine different agencies and/or governments in the Catoctin area.

The primary purpose of the Council is to provide advisement and advocacy to the Catoctin CASS program. Examples of advisement and advocacy include:

  • Needs assessment of the Catoctin families

  • Netweork to determine existing services

  • Critical feedback to the Coordinator when discussing specific program development and future vision for Catoctin CASS

  • Coordination of specific projects as needed (i.e. fund raising)

  • Represent Catoctin CASS in the community by speaking about CASS to the public when needed

  • Other duties as determined by the Council and the Coordinator

The Catoctin CASS Advisory Council meets quarterly at the Catoctin CASS office in Emmitsburg, on Wednesdays from 4:00 - 5:00 p.m. Bill Derbyshire, Catoctin CASS Coordinator, chairs the meetings.
